I must be one of the few who watch it.

They show regular live Scottish Championship football on Friday nights during the season. There are other shows also.

The coverage is very good and at half time there is a historical football related feature.

It's interesting that the article suggests the channel was produced to placate the SNP as the highland sides are featured a lot.

On a more interesting note, who uses the word "outwith" in their daily speech? Is it a Scots thing?

Yes, it is a common part of everyday speech. There are a fair few words like that in Scots English that you wouldn't hear elsewhere. I was once informed by St Johnstone FC that I could "uplift my briefs" for a game I was attending up until noon of the day of the match.
